The Goods and Services Tax Network (GSTN) has resolved an issue that caused duplicate entries in GSTR 2B for some taxpayers. A corrected GSTR 2B is now available. Taxpayers are strongly advised to verify their Input Tax Credit (ITC) values against the law before filing their GSTR 3B returns. It's recommended to cross-reference figures from the auto-drafted GSTR 2B, the system-generated GSTR 3B PDF, or by hovering over Table 4 in GSTR 3B, especially if discrepancies arise with the pre-filled data.
